Technology Support Technician

Job Description

The Technology Support Technician provides responsive, customer-focused technical support to faculty, staff, students, and families, ensuring the reliable operation of technology that supports teaching, learning, and school operations. This position serves as the primary front-line resource for technology support, assisting users with hardware, software, classroom technology, audiovisual systems, and device management.

Working under the direction of the Educational Technology Manager, the Technology Support Technician troubleshoots technical issues, maintains technology equipment, supports classroom and event technology, and assists with implementing technology initiatives. The technician also contributes to staff training, technology documentation, and continuous improvement of technology services.

Success in this position is measured by exceptional customer service, timely resolution of support requests, effective communication, and a commitment to helping users confidently utilize technology.

Duties and Responsibilities Customer Support
  • Serve as the primary point of contact for technology support requests from faculty, staff, students, and families through the help desk, phone, email, and walk-in support.
  • Diagnose and resolve hardware, software, printing, classroom technology, and account-related issues in a timely and professional manner.
  • Provide excellent customer service while communicating technical information clearly, supportively, and in a user-friendly manner.
  • Escalate complex technical issues to the Educational Technology Manager or external technology vendors as appropriate.
Technology Operations
  • Install, configure, maintain, and troubleshoot computers, Chromebooks, mobile devices, printers, software, peripherals, and classroom technology.
  • Support Google Workspace, device management systems, user accounts, and other instructional and operational technology platforms.
  • Perform preliminary troubleshooting for network and connectivity issues and coordinate with managed service providers as needed.
  • Maintain accurate technology asset inventory, equipment lifecycle records, and support documentation.
  • Evaluate damaged devices and coordinate repairs, warranty claims, and vendor service requests.
Classroom & AV Technology
  • Support classroom technology, including projectors, sound systems, presentation equipment, and other instructional technology.
  • Assist with setup, operation, and teardown of audiovisual equipment for school events, performances, meetings, and special activities, including occasional evenings and weekends.
  • Assist teachers with classroom technology needs and provide one-on-one support to build confidence and improve the effective use of technology.
  • Collaborate with the Educational Technology Manager to support technology initiatives, classroom technology implementations, and school wide projects.
  • Assist in developing user guides, knowledge base articles, and technology documentation.
  • Provide basic technology orientation and training for faculty and staff as requested.
  • Identify recurring technology issues and recommend improvements to enhance technology services and user experience.
  • Perform other duties as assigned.
